WRIST-WORN DEVICE AND PARAMETER ADJUSTING METHOD USING THEREOF
First Claim
Patent Images
1. A wrist-worn device capable of working in a plurality of working modes, the wrist-worn device comprising:
- a case;
a display;
a touch sensitive unit fixed to the case; and
a processor configured to monitor a period of time or number of separate touches that a user carries out on the touch sensitive unit, and to switch a current working mode of the wrist-worn device to the next one if the period of time or number of separate touches equals to or exceeds a preset value, and the processor being configured to determine the point(s) of touch on the touch sensitive unit to determine the track of any moving touches, wherein if the track of any moving touches matches a stored first track, the processor selects a default parameter in the current work mode, and if the touch track matches a stored second track, the processor adjusts a value of the selected parameter.

Abstract
An exemplary adjusting method is implemented by a wrist-worn device. The wrist-worn device is capable of working in several modes. The wrist-worn device includes a case, a display, and a touch sensitive unit. The touch sensitive unit is fixed to the case. The method includes: monitoring touches on the touch sensitive unit, and switch from a current working mode to another working mode in a cycle if the touches are recognized after comparison with stored touches.

6. A parameter adjusting method implemented by a wrist-worn device, the wrist-worn device capable of working in a plurality of working modes, the wrist-worn device comprising a case, a display, and a touch sensitive unit, the touch sensitive unit being fixed to the case, the method comprising:
-
monitoring a period of time or number of separate touches that a user carries out on the touch sensitive unit, and to switch current working mode to the next one if the period of time or number of separate touches equals to or exceeds a preset value; determining the point(s) of touch on the touch sensitive unit to determine the track of any moving touches; selecting a default parameter in the current work mode when the track of any moving touches matching a stored first track; and adjusting a value of the selected parameter when the track of any moving touches matching a stored second track. - View Dependent Claims (7, 8, 9, 10)
